CerebrumX To Use Ford Connected Vehicle Data For Usage-Based Car Insurance

AI-driven automotive data services and management platform CerebrumX Lab will incorporate Ford connected vehicle data to support its data-driven usage-based insurance (UBI) as-a-service model for insurers. The US-based tech company said the model offers a quicker and more cost-effective implementation of UBI programmes by using embedded telematics for eligible Ford and Lincoln connected vehicles.   

According to CerebrumX, UBI programmes using embedded connected vehicle systems, with the consent of customers, provide more accurate and reliable driving data, allowing insurers to reward safe driver behaviour with opportunities for reduced personalised premiums.

For customers who opt in, CerebrumX’s Augmented Deep Learning Platform (ADLP) collects and analyses data directly from eligible Ford and Lincoln vehicles to generate a driver and a vehicle score with no additional hardware or apps required. The score helps insurers better assess risk and build more accurate, personalised policies for their customers, such as Pay As You Drive and Pay How You Drive, to support safe driving and optimise loss claims.

“By opting into usage-based insurance, Ford and Lincoln owners can be rewarded for their good driving habits with more personalised insurance offerings,” said Amy Graham, Services Marketing Director at Ford Motor Company. “CerebrumX’s platform creates another opportunity for Ford and Lincoln owners to achieve insurance benefits with their vehicle’s connectivity to help reduce their total cost of vehicle ownership.”

CerebrumX said the unique UBI-as-a-service model acts as a “one-stop solution”, making it easier for insurers to launch UBI programmes that bundle automotive data, AI-powered scores, and insights with handheld assistance in adherence to regulatory policies. CerebrumX accelerates the implementation of end-to-end services such as consent handling, integration of the driver score with existing generalised linear models (GLM), state filing services support, driver coaching, and UBI performance evaluation.

“With CerebrumX’s UBI-as-a-service model, powered by AI-driven insights and accurate driver behaviour, we aim to streamline the entire usage-based insurance rollout process making it flexible and cost-effective,” said Sandip Ranjhan, Chief Executive Officer of CerebrumX. “The UBI market is set to grow by nearly 30 per cent in the next five years. The addition of Ford and Lincoln vehicles to CerebrumX’s UBI-as-a-service programme will help Insurance providers extend coverage and scale, resulting in better adoption by the end consumer.”
